The collection of reviews paints a care facility that prompts mixed feelings and serious concerns, even as it garners some praise from families who have seen the staff in action. On the one hand, there is genuine appreciation for certain members of the team and for the general atmosphere when things go right. On the other hand, multiple accounts raise red flags about cleanliness, safety, consistency in medical care, and financial practices. Taken together, the reviews tell a story of a place that has potential but is also slipping on essential safeguards.
From the outset, several reviewers acknowledge that the physical and nursing teams can be excellent in the right moments. One reviewer notes that the physical therapy and rehabilitation staff are "phenomenal" and that the overall staff are friendly and accommodating upon arrival. In this view, the caregivers were able to help their loved one look clean, and they described the environment as home-like and pleasant. This positive sentiment and appreciation for the hard work of the non-nursing staff contrast with the more problematic experiences described elsewhere, underscoring that individual interactions can vary widely within the same facility.
But there are strong cautions about cleanliness and daily operations. A number of accounts describe ongoing housekeeping and sanitation problems: dirty counters in the kitchen area, a stove and microwave with food still stuck on them, and a sink area with dirty old towels and spills. One reviewer even notes a persistent lack of activity or structured programming, and makes the broader point that basic upkeep and organized routines appear to be missing. The combination of filth in common spaces and a perceived lack of activity or engagement for residents creates a troubling picture of an environment that should be more sanitary and lively.
Care quality and patient safety emerge as even more pressing concerns in several anecdotes. A nurse administering IV meds in a central line allegedly provided someone else's medication, prompting the patient to speak up and insist on the correct one being given after being shown how to verify labels. Related warnings emphasize inconsistent nursing attentiveness and a lack of awareness about patient needs by certain staff members, with some reviewers explicitly stating they would report issues to the state. There are also stark warnings about equipment and room conditions: nails protruding from walls, a cramped room shared with another elderly resident, a broken wheelchair that disintegrated under use, and the absence of chairs in a room described as small - forcing a patient to sit on a potty chair. These factors culminated in a frightening incident where a patient reportedly fell, was found on the floor, and had to be rushed to the hospital, underscoring serious safety lapses and a perceived lack of proactive monitoring and timely response.
The facility's recent performance in clinical care is acknowledged in a mixed light. One reviewer mentions a period of dedicated wound care spanning about 21 days, thanking the staff for the attention given to that specific need. This positive note highlights that when specialized care is present and properly delivered, the facility can meet important clinical expectations. It also suggests that care quality may be uneven, with certain departments performing well while others struggle to maintain consistent standards across all residents and scenarios.
Financial handling, particularly after a loved one has died, emerges as one of the most alarming threads in the reviews. A specific case describes a son being charged nearly $9,000 in fees for services allegedly covered by Medicare, with the facility having told the family that coverage existed but then pursuing posthumous charges. The complaint centers on a policy of not allowing residents to stay if they cannot pay and the troubling claim that charges continued after the resident's death. This is presented as a grave breach of trust and ethics, raising questions about the facility's billing practices and the burden placed on families during already difficult times.
A final note appears to balance the overall impression with a slightly more tempered, even optimistic outlook. Another reviewer acknowledges an undistinguished reputation but asserts that the place is actually okay, especially for families facing tight finances. They point to recent renovations and new management as signals of improvement, suggesting that while it may not be the fanciest option, it can still represent a practical and affordable choice for loved ones when cost is a major constraint. This perspective reinforces the sense that the facility's merit lies largely in financial accessibility and administrative changes, rather than in unanimous acclaim for care quality across all areas.
In sum, the reviews present a facility with real strengths and meaningful weaknesses. The staff and atmosphere can be welcoming, and there are instances of good clinical care and a home-like environment. Yet persistent cleanliness issues, safety hazards, inconsistent medical oversight, and troubling billing practices cast a long shadow over the overall experience. Families considering this place would do well to verify specific departments, ask pointed questions about daily housekeeping and safety protocols, ensure there are clear checks on medications, and review any financial arrangements carefully before committing. The divergence in experiences emphasizes the importance of personal visits, direct conversations with both administration and front-line staff, and vigilant oversight to safeguard residents' health, safety, and financial wellbeing.

In-Depth Look at the VA Aid and Attendance Program
The VA Aid and Attendance program offers financial assistance to veterans needing help with daily activities due to health issues, available through a pension for low-income wartime veterans or an allowance for 100% disabled individuals. Eligibility depends on medical documentation of care needs and navigating guidelines about income and service history, with funds being usable for various healthcare-related expenses.
